I went to curves for a long time. It will definitely tone you if you work the machines fully. I saw many women who either did the machines wrong or were barely making an effort with them.

Weight loss depends on diet too. If you dont watch the diet, no exercise will help you lose 20-30 lbs.

Curves franchises have been closing at a very high rate. There were a few near me that all closed down. Corporate curves is not making it easy for the franchises to make money. So make sure your curves has no intentions of closing down after you pay your sign up fee.

I now go to a regular gym. I like the change of pace, but I liked the 1/2 hour time curves took much better.
